Calcium carbonate the chief component of limestone is a widely used amendment to neutralie soil acidity and to supply calcium Ca for plant nutrition. The term lime can refer to several products but for agricultural use it generally refers to ground limestone

Calcium carbonate is an important trace element for plants. It can help the soil convert nutrients into a more usable form. Calcium carbonate in the form of lime has many uses including To raise the pH of acidic soil in order to sweeten it. As a deodorier in stables barns and greenhouses. As a
Calcium carbonate is an excellent product for raising the pH of soil. Most not all plants do best in soils with a pH between 5.5 and 6.5. Calcium carbonate can be broadcast over and incorporated into soils in need of a dose of alkalinity

Calcium in the form of calcium pectate is responsible for holding together the cell walls of plants. When calcium is deficient new tissue such as root tips young leaves and shoot tips often exhibit distorted growth from improper cell wall formation.
